Annual Maintenance cost

ROUTINE MAINTENANCE

  • Performing preventative maintenance and optimization services every 90 days (4 times per year). 
  • Cleaning up your computer(s), removing any spyware, adware, malware, viruses, and general computer "clutter" that accumulates over time and slows down your system's performance. 

  • Since dust accumulates inside your system (preventing critical components from cooling properly), IT staffs physically need to clean computer system as well.

  •  Updating all operating system and program files, and optimize your system for best possible performance.  

  • Backing up your files and data per a pre-arranged backup protocol and verify that your backup systems are functioning properly. 

  • Replacement cost of broken down or  worn out parts

Annual Energy Cost (source: Wyse Technologies inc. US.)

Annual energy cost of your computer= n*p*h*52*c

n is the number of desktop devices

p is the power in kilowatts consumed by one PC

h is the number of hours each week the devices are turned on

52 is the number of weeks in a year

c is the energy cost per kilowatt-hour

(NB: Desktop PC consumes 0.3Kilowatt, a Thin Client PC 0.005kilowatt)

CALCULATION:

A 1000 workstation office working 50hrs per week in a region where the energy cost is $0.4per kilowatt-hr.  

Annual Energy Cost= 1000*p*50*52*0.4
